Tanzania is marking a significant financial milestone by listing its inaugural Tanzanian shilling-denominated offshore bond on the London Stock Exchange (LSE) on Friday, July 24, 2026 123. This move represents a major step for the Tanzanian government in attracting long-term international investment and diversifying its funding sources 3.
Key Details of the Listing
The listing is a collaborative effort, with the International Finance Corporation (IFC) backing the bond 23. Tanzania's Finance Minister, Khamis Mussa Omar, is in London for a six-day working visit to officiate this historic event 24.

Role of the International Finance Corporation (IFC)
The International Finance Corporation (IFC), a member of the World Bank Group, plays a pivotal role in this initiative. The IFC has issued this first offshore Tanzanian shilling-denominated bond, facilitating Tanzania's access to international capital markets 34.
Broader Context
This event follows previous engagements by Tanzania in the international financial arena. For instance, NMB Bank, a Tanzanian entity, previously became the first to list a corporate bond on the LSE 5. Additionally, Tanzania has been exploring the possibility of issuing its first international bond (Eurobond) in over a decade, holding investor roadshows in London to gauge appetite 10.
The bonds themselves are fixed-rate and are also listed on the Dar es Salaam Stock Exchange, with secondary trading in multiples of TZS 100,000 set to commence on Friday, July 24, 2026 6. The final maturity date for these bonds is July 23, 2036 6.
